Sumac (also known by sumak, sumack, or by its scientific name Rhus coriaria) is a spice most commonly used in Middle Eastern cuisine. It's the fifth most used Middle Eastern spice, trailing just a few spots behind cumin, nutmeg, cardamom, and turmeric. READ ALSO: 7 Best Cardamom Substitute Choices You Probably Didn't Know.

Sumac Rice (Somagh Polo) is a delicious Persian dish that combines fragrant basmati rice with tangy sumac and fresh herbs. Sumac is a red spice that has a sour and lemony flavor, and is often used in Middle Eastern and Mediterranean cuisines. Sumac rice is traditionally served with meat balls or fish.

Do check if your sumac spice contains salt. Do store sumac correctly. Do use sumac as a garnish as well as a seasoning. Do feel free to add sumac to your food right at the table. Don't limit your use of sumac to seasoning food. Don't consume sumac if you are allergic to cashews or mangoes. Don't confuse the sumac spice with poison sumac.

Sumac spice that is used in cooking is red, more like a deeper berry color. It comes from sumac berries, which are turned into a coarse powder, sifted, and sold in spice bottles for culinary use. This deep red spice is the main flavor maker in some traditional Middle Eastern dishes like fattoush salad and musakhan, but it is a versatile spice.
